Japan Engine Corporation
Q1 FY2027 Financial Summary (Japanese GAAP) [Consolidated]
For the first quarter of FY2027, net sales were 7,382 million yen (YoY -11.4%), operating income 1,874 million yen (+9.9%), ordinary income 2,065 million yen (+9.1%), and quarterly net income attributable to owners of parent 1,489 million yen (+2.3%). Improved performance was driven by strong repair parts and license business, with the full-year forecast unchanged. Orders received were 10,496 million yen, and order backlog expanded to 37,567 million yen.

Overview of Operating Results
While sales of marine internal combustion engines declined, overall profitability was maintained through growth in after-sales service and licensing-related activities. In line with the Second Medium-Term Plan, the '1T3D Diversification Strategy' is being pursued, with three domains—marine internal combustion engines, after-sales service, and licenses—growing in a complementary manner. Development and social adoption of next-generation decarbonized fuel engines are being advanced with the aim of expanding global market share.
Outlook and Financial Position
Full-year earnings guidance remains unchanged from the announcement. Sales are expected to be slightly lower due to the impact of marine internal combustion engines, but profits are expected to remain solid. Orders received and order backlog remain above the previous year, supporting growth through expanded production capacity and ample backlog. The financial position shows total assets of 35,343 million yen, equity ratio of 54.3%, and treasury stock at 16,383 shares.
